(57) [Summary] [Structure] A cushioning material for packaging which is formed by bending a strip-shaped plate-shaped member 1 made of paper.
It has a hole portion 15 which is held in a bent state by being fitted into the housing and into which a part of the article to be packed is fitted. [Effect] Since no adhesive or the like is used, it is easy to assemble, and since it is made of paper, it is easy to dispose of it or recycle it.
